What is the Facial serums



 Facial serums are a concentrated form of skincare that can provide a variety of benefits for the skin. They are formulated with high concentrations of active ingredients that can penetrate deep into the skin to deliver targeted results. They are typically applied before moisturizer and can be used to address a wide range of skin concerns such as aging, acne, and hyperpigmentation.

 

Anti-aging serums are formulated with ingredients such as retinol, vitamin C, and hyaluronic acid to help re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les. They can also help to improve the texture and tone of the skin for a more youthful-looking complexion.

 

Acne-fighting serums are formulated with ingredients such as salicylic acid and benzoyl peroxide to help reduce the appearance of blemishes and unclog pores. They can also help to prevent future breakouts.

 

Brightening serums are formulated with ingredients such as vitamin C, kojic acid, and niacinamide to help even out skin tone and reduce the appearance of dark spots.

 

Hydrating serums are formulated with ingredients such as hyaluronic acid and glycerin to help plump up the skin and provide intense hydration.

 

It's important to note that not all serums are suitable for all skin types, so it's important to choose a serum that is appropriate for your skin type and concerns. It's also important to follow the instructions for use and the recommended frequency of use for the serum.
